gcc/fortran/ChangeLog:
PR fortran/107899
* resolve.cc (resolve_deallocate_expr): Avoid NULL pointer dereference
on invalid CLASS variable.
gcc/testsuite/ChangeLog:
PR fortran/107899
* gfortran.dg/pr107899.f90: New test.
